Understanding EN 1092-1 Type 1 Flange Standards in Industry In the realm of industrial applications, flange standards play an essential role in ensuring the reliability and integrity of piping systems. One such standard that is widely recognized is EN 1092-1 Type 1. This standard belongs to a series focused on the design and manufacturing specifications for flanges used in various industrial services, setting requirements that cater to different pressure and temperature classes. Overview of EN 1092-1 EN 1092-1 is part of the European Norm (EN) series that addresses the design, manufacturing, and testing of flanges. Specifically, Type 1 refers to a specific type of flange that features a flat face and is available in various nominal sizes and pressure ratings. This standard is particularly significant as it aligns with broader compliance standards relevant to industries such as oil and gas, water treatment, and chemical processing. The design of Type 1 flanges is intended to connect pipes, valves, pumps, and other equipment, establishing a secure mechanical joint that can withstand the operational conditions of the system. The specifications cover parameters such as dimensions, materials, and performance criteria, ensuring uniformity and compatibility across different manufacturers and applications. Applications of EN 1092-1 Type 1 Flanges Type 1 flanges are commonly used across various sectors, including but not limited to - Oil and Gas Industry In this sector, piping systems are critical for transporting oil, gas, and related products. EN 1092-1 Type 1 flanges are instrumental in connecting pipes and ensuring leak-proof joints under extreme conditions. en 1092 1 type 1 - Water Treatment Plants The reliable performance of flanged connections in water treatment facilities is paramount. Type 1 flanges may be employed to connect different pieces of equipment, contributing to the efficiency and safety of water distribution systems. - Chemical Processing Within chemical plants, the integrity of piping systems is vital due to the hazardous nature of many chemicals involved. Using standards like EN 1092-1 mitigates risks associated with leaks and equipment failures, enhancing worker safety and environmental protection. Key Characteristics of EN 1092-1 Type 1 Flanges 1. Material Specifications EN 1092-1 Type 1 flanges can be manufactured from a variety of materials, including carbon steel, stainless steel, and other alloys. The choice of material depends on the specific service conditions, including the nature of the fluids being transported, temperature ranges, and possible corrosive elements. 2. Size and Pressure Rating The standard provides detailed tables that specify dimensions, including bolt hole patterns and flange thickness, to ensure compatibility between different systems. The pressure ratings are categorized to accommodate both low and high-pressure applications. 3. Testing and Quality Assurance Compliance with EN 1092-1 ensures that all flanges undergo rigorous testing processes to verify their mechanical properties and leak-tightness. Manufacturers are often required to provide certifications and test reports to confirm adherence to the standard.
